yáng gān jú jìn pào
infusion of chamomile
The term '洋甘菊浸泡' refers to a tea or beverage made by steeping chamomile flowers in hot water. Chamomile is commonly used for its calming properties and is often consumed to help with relaxation and sleep. In Chinese culture, herbal infusions, including chamomile, are popular for their health benefits and soothing effects.
